and Estates Paralegal Duties: The candidate will be drafting tax returns, inventories, accounts, and related supporting information and related documentation for property transfers and distributions. Coordinating periodic income and principal distributions from trusts and the transfer of assets into trusts. Maintaining financial records or trusts. Preparing schedule of allocations to trusts will.
